The invention relates to a motorcycle wheel driving mechanism which is provided with a single-arm bottom fork installed on a frame through a bottom fork shaft and a motor support fixedly connected to the frame, one side of a wheel is installed on the single-arm bottom fork, a driving motor is installed on the motor support, and the driving motor is in transmission connection with the wheel through a universal joint half shaft. The driving motor of the motorcycle is designed on one side of the wheel and is in transmission connection with the wheel through the universal joint half shaft, and meanwhile, the motor in the driving motor and the planetary reducer are integrally designed, so that the size of the whole driving motor is greatly reduced, and the limited space of the side part of the wheel is saved; the wheel is fixed through the combination of the single-arm bottom fork and the universal joint half shaft, on the premise that the position of the driving motor is not affected, the wheel can move up and down relative to the position of the driving motor in a self-adaptive mode according to road conditions, the unsprung weight can be greatly reduced through the structure, operation is more stable, noise is effectively reduced, and the comfort of a driver is greatly improved.
